Nigeria@65: Mayor Akpodoro Salutes Nigerians, Declares Tinubu Father of Modern Nigeria

by Emerald Nigeria
October 1, 2025
in Inside Delta
ShareTweetShareShare

By His Excellency, Mayor Eshanekpe Israel (Akpodoro)
Head, Association of Urhobo Mayoral Family Crown (AUMFC); Mayor of Urhoboland

Fellow Nigerians,

Today, as we celebrate 65 years of nationhood, we rejoice in the gift of Nigeria – a nation under God, blessed with resilience, unity, and boundless potential. October 1, 1960, marked the dawn of our independence, and since then, despite challenges, we have continued to stand tall among the nations of the world.

Mayor of urhoboland

We have overcome storms, endured trials, and remained indivisible. Our unity, our shared heritage, and our commitment to progress are reasons to celebrate. Indeed, Happy Birthday, Nigeria!

Celebrating Leadership and Nationhood

On this historic day, I extend heartfelt congratulations to the President and Commander-in-Chief, Asiwaju Bola Ahmed Tinubu, GCFR. His courage, patriotism, and relentless drive for reform have placed Nigeria on the path of greatness.

Since assuming office, President Tinubu has shown remarkable political will and unwavering commitment to building a prosperous nation. His policies and reforms are reshaping Nigeria’s destiny, restoring hope, and positioning us as a proud member of the global community.

Achievements of President Tinubu

In just two years, this administration has recorded outstanding milestones:

Economic Growth: Nigeria’s GDP rose from ₦269.29 trillion in May 2023 to ₦372.8 trillion today, with 3.84% quarterly growth in 2024 – our best in a decade.

Energy Independence: Nigeria has moved from Africa’s top fuel importer to West Africa’s leading refined fuel exporter.

Workers’ Welfare: A new minimum wage of ₦70,000 for federal workers has been approved and implemented.

Infrastructure: Two legacy super highways – the 1,068km Illela-Sokoto-Badagry and the 750km Lagos-Calabar Coastal Road – are underway.

Debt Reduction: National debt has dropped from $113.7 billion to $97 billion, while federal allocations to states have doubled.

Education & Empowerment: The Student Loan Initiative (NELFUND) has empowered nearly one million indigent Nigerians.

Stability in Governance: Peaceful relations among the Executive, Legislature, and Judiciary have been maintained, with a zero-tolerance stance on corruption.

International Recognition: Nigeria has secured stronger diplomatic ties with countries like Brazil and Seychelles while improving our global standing.

Infrastructure & Power: Abuja’s power supply has improved with the $2 billion, 1,350MW Gwagwalada Independent Power Plant.

Trade & Reserves: Nigeria achieved a record trade surplus of $14.31 billion in 2024 and boosted foreign reserves to $40.1 billion.

Aviation Reform: Nnamdi Azikiwe International Airport, Abuja, is now the most modern in Sub-Saharan Africa.

These are not mere promises – they are tangible results delivered within a short time. If such transformation is possible in two years, imagine what awaits Nigeria if President Tinubu continues beyond 2027.
